AN influencer has died while undergoing a £4,000 nose job operation at an elite clinic after a possible deadly “reaction to anaesthetic”.
Image guru Marina Lebedeva, 31, wanted the rhinoplasty procedure to “correct” the shape of her nose, say reports.

As surgery was underway at a Russian clinic her temperature soared possibly as a result of a reaction against the anaesthetic.
She died as the plastic surgeons and paramedics fought to save her at Artibeaut clinic in St Petersburg.
The private clinic had called an ambulance as soon as they realised she was in trouble.
A video recorded the surgery and released by RenTV will be used as evidence.
A criminal case into medical negligence has been opened in St Petersburg, with surgeons facing up to six years in jail if convicted.
The image consultant’s husband rushed back to the city from a business trip when he was told about her tragic death.

“The doctors are shocked, and say this happens once in a million surgeries,” said one report.
The clinic’s director Alexander Efremov said the patient had passed multiple tests before the nose job, which was carried out by highly-qualified medics.
He believes a genetic condition led to her death, say reports.
“A forensic medical examination will be carried out, but I can say that we performed the surgery according to all normal standards,” he said.
“If some violation occurred, it would be the first such case.”
The Russian Investigative Committee said it was seeking “to establish the circumstances and cause of the woman's death.
"The investigation of the criminal case continues.”
